蜗牛兼职平台:Vue.js与SpringBoot整合实现

需积分: 0 0 下载量 109 浏览量 更新于2024-11-14 收藏 27.57MB ZIP 举报
资源摘要信息:"蜗牛兼职平台是一个基于Web技术开发的综合性兼职信息服务平台,采用当前流行的前后端分离架构,后端使用Java语言结合SpringBoot框架,前端使用Vue.js框架进行构建。平台主要面向管理员和普通用户,提供了完整的兼职信息服务功能,包括但不限于兼职信息发布、职位申请处理、用户留言互动以及用户和企业的基础信息管理。 一、技术架构 该平台的技术架构主要分为前端、后端以及数据库三个部分。 1. 前端:使用Vue.js框架构建用户网页端,实现了动态的数据交互和组件化界面设计,为用户提供直观易用的界面。 2. 后端:使用SpringBoot框架简化了基于Spring的应用开发,快速搭建项目并进行模块化配置,提高了开发效率和项目维护的便利性。 3. 数据库:采用MySQL数据库存储所有业务数据,保证数据的安全性和稳定性。 二、功能模块 1. 管理后台:为管理员提供了一个功能强大的后台管理系统,可以对用户信息、企业信息、兼职信息进行增删改查等操作。 2. 用户网页端:为普通用户提供了一个简洁友好的界面,用户可以在平台上浏览兼职信息,提交职位申请,查看留言及回复。 3. 兼职信息模块:允许用户查看不同类型的兼职工作,并且可以按照职位、地区等条件进行筛选。 4. 职位申请模块:用户可以对感兴趣的兼职职位进行在线申请,并在系统中跟踪申请状态。 5. 留言板模块:提供一个交流平台,用户可以在此发表对兼职的看法和建议,企业也可以进行回复互动。 6. 用户管理:管理员可以管理注册用户的个人信息和权限设置。 7. 企业管理:管理员可以管理企业用户,包括企业信息审核、企业发布职位审核等。 8. 系统基础模块:包括用户认证、权限控制、日志记录等基础功能。 三、项目资源文件 1. 功能文档.doc:详细记录了蜗牛兼职平台的功能需求、业务流程和用户操作指南。 2. 答辩PPT.ppt:包含了项目答辩时的演示文稿,概述了项目的设计理念、技术实现以及特色功能。 3. T034.sql:包含了平台数据库的结构定义和初始数据脚本,方便部署和初始化环境。 4. back:包含后端源代码的文件夹,用户可以通过该文件夹访问后端服务的实现细节。 5. front:包含前端源代码的文件夹,用户可以通过该文件夹访问前端页面和前端逻辑的实现细节。 四、学习和参考资源 为了帮助用户更好地理解和使用蜗牛兼职平台,提供了以下学习资源: - 项目录屏:通过B站链接可以查看实际操作和功能演示视频,以便更直观地了解平台的运作流程。 - 启动教程:为用户提供详细的系统部署和启动步骤,帮助用户快速上手。 - 项目讲解视频:通过视频讲解平台的关键技术点和特色功能,提供深入的技术理解。 综上所述,蜗牛兼职平台是一个功能完善、设计现代的在线兼职信息服务解决方案,它不仅为用户和企业提供了便利的信息交流平台,也为技术人员提供了学习和实践的机会。"